Career
Kirishima is a Mongolian *ozeki* competing for Otowayama stable. He made his professional debut in March 2015 and has climbed steadily through the ranks. Standing 186 cm and weighing 149 kg, he reached *sekiwake* by March 2026, where he posted a strong 12–3 record. That performance earned him promotion to *ozeki* for the May 2026 tournament, where he opened his tenure at sumo's second-highest rank with an 8–2 showing.
His attack centers on pushing techniques, with throws and belt work as secondary weapons.
